Mmmmmm-mm! The aroma of this alone is intoxicating and inviting. Once you take that first sip you get exactly what you were signaled to expect - a rich but refreshing, creamy, pastel-colored, not too sweet drink that reminds you of a chaise lounge, pool and sunshine. I used Splenda rather than sugar and half-and-half rather than cream but beyond that, stuck to the recipe. I generally make Hubs his preferred yogurt-based smoothies but for me today, this was a refreshing and welcome change. Normally I might garnish this like a Pina Colada - a wedge of pineapple perhaps, a maraschino cherry and a paper umbrella of course, but this time we just slurped this up straight out of the blender, the two of us cleaning up this "4-serving" recipe in no time. Loved it.

I am rating this on inspiration, not as the recipe is written. I used a mango, forgot about the ice cubes (didn't have the recipe in front of me), omitted the sugar, used 1 1/4 cups of freshly cut pineapple, 1/2 cup soy milk, and 1/2 cup freshly made coconut milk. It was fantastic! It was a great start to my day!
